WebA data architecture describes how data is managed--from collection through to transformation, distribution, and consumption. It sets the blueprint for data and the way it flows through data storage systems. It is foundational to data processing operations and artificial intelligence (AI) applications. WebJul 28, 2024 · A data architect's responsibilities include the following: Designs the data architecture, including databases, file systems, data warehouses, data lakes, analytics sandboxes and data science hubs.
